MADISON – Marita Carol Gregory, 56, passed away peacefully on Wednesday, November 12, 2025, surrounded by her family. Marita was born in Forsyth County on April 22, 1969. She worked for over 15 years at Hudson Automotive and attended The Crossing Church in Kernersville. She was most recently very proud of obtaining her Bachelors Degree in Business Administration from UNC-Greensboro.
Marita loved crafting and traveling with family. Her joyful spirit and happy heart complimented her love for music and dancing. But the main focus of her heart was spending time with her family and grandkids – especially sharing with them her love of food and fellowship.
Marita was preceded in death by her father, Buford “PawPaw” Sadler; and grandparents, Lillie Mae and John Dewitt Thomas.
Surviving are her husband of 32 years, Dale Gregory; three daughters, Alexis Tilley (husband, Bray), Madison Hodges (husband, Jarrett), and Victoria Gregory (fiance’, Weston Hughes); two grandchildren, Braxton and Georgia Tilley; her mother, Carol Sadler; and her mother-in-law, Norma Gregory.
A service to celebrate her life will be held at 3:00 p.m. Sunday, November 16, 2025, at Hayworth-Miller Kernersville Chapel with Pastor Chris Booth officiating.
